## Deployment: Request Tracing

Heads up, support folks: every request through the Pondwick stack gets a trace ID stamped at the edge by the Larkspur gateway, and it follows the call through all downstream services. If a customer reports a slow checkout, grab that ID first — it saves everyone time. The tracer reads these values at startup.

config for haweg-bagag:
[kasath]
host = kasath.qirvancorp.internal
user = kasath_svc
database = kasath_prod

For the weekly sync: step 4 of the Thornvale rollout swaps the legacy reset-token generator for the new time-boxed scheme. Deploy the auth service first, then the mailer, so in-flight tokens remain valid during the overlap window (fifteen minutes). Verify the /reset/health endpoint reports scheme v2 before proceeding. The new generator signs tokens with a credential stored in the auth service's env file rather than the old keyring. Open that file and add the signing entry on the following line.

sealed setting: RELAY_SECRET5=82864

CI note for support: the Pondcast feed validator keeps flaking on the nightly run. It's not the feeds — the validator container at Brightmoor CI pulls an outdated schema bundle when the cache node restarts, so valid enclosures get flagged as malformed. Quick fix: re-run the job after clearing the schema cache step. If a customer reports false failures, check which build they hit. The good build carries this token.

build token for kagaf-hahof: htk14_9d3d4d26d7d8de